Brief of Bidding
Bid Title
Project for Upgrading Green Automotive Maintenance Technology for VTCs in Egypt
Summary of Services
-
Establishment of development plans for automotive vocational training centers
-
Development of curricula and teaching materials that align with labor market demands (new development and revisions)
-
Strengthening the capabilities of vocational education administrators and technical instructors
-
Support for automotive maintenance practical training equipment
-
Establishment of an industry-academia cooperation system
-
Project management (performance management, monitoring, and promotion)

A.
Employer
:
Korea International Cooperation Agency (KOICA)
B.
Bid Type
: International Bidding, Open Competitive Bidding
C.
Selection of the Successful Bidders
:
a)
Conclusion of contract by negotiation (technical proposal (90%) and price
quotation (10%)).
b)
Bidders that receive less than 8
5
out of 100 points at the technical proposal evaluation shall be disqualified from negotiations.
c)
Conclus
ion of contract by negotiation
.
